Troops of Operation Hadin Kai Kill 18 Terrorists in Borno

On Friday, troops of Operation Hadin Kai killed at least 18 terrorists in Borno State after disrupting a meeting of suspected high-profile insurgents at Tumbunma Baba. The operation was conducted following weeks of intelligence gathering that indicated senior terrorist elements were using the area as a meeting and logistics hub.
Cap. Mohammed Goni, the acting Military Information Officer of Operation Hadin Kai, stated that surveillance operations intensified after confirming the presence of terrorists.
The operation, which took place in the early hours of Friday, involved both air and ground components of the North-East Joint Task Force. Military aircraft targeted identified locations while ground troops blocked escape routes, successfully destroying structures and neutralizing over 18 terrorists.
An assessment post-operation indicated that approximately 85 percent of the objectives were achieved. Goni emphasized the effectiveness of intelligence-led operations and assured residents that efforts would continue to prevent terrorist activities in the region.
